To put it shortly Euron is one of the most evil, terrifying, and mysterious men in the entire asoiaf book series. He spent years in exile sailing the oceans. In comparison, the show version of Euron is a total loser! If there is an example of a worse book to show character adaptation that Euron Greyjoy then I am not aware.

Even though Littlefinger is a master manipulator on the books, the best thing Martin did to him (in my opinion) was the subversion! (and I don't mean making him suddenly dumb like the show does) He is constantly making crazy alegations, like the first thing he says when me meet the character on the first book was that he and Catelyn lost their virginity together but that she was forced to marry a Stark. Since we, as readers, have access to Catelyn as a narrator, we know that to be false right as he says it, but it DOES sound like the kind of lie a lecherous and pervy jilted lover would create, so we at once create an idea of what kind of character he is and misjudge his motivations for the first of maaany times.Then we have his betrayal of Ned, him moving his pieces for ever greater power... but then... then we have the moment in the Eyre when Lysa is confessing her love for him, and he is playing the game... until she, offhandedly, confesses that, when he was a kid, delirious with fever, she pretended to be Catelyn and slept with him. That gives him pause, Petyr goes blank for a moment... and procedes to declare undying love for Cat and throw Lysa through the Moondoor. A few chapters later, Sansa comments that after that day he begun to go slowly insane, shattered. One half of him, that Sansa calls "Petyr" is protective, of her, like a father, and very much depressed, the other, which she calls "the Littlefinger" is kind of derranged and sometimes confuses her for her mother, gets drunk, and cries himself to sleep or something... So, hear me out: that was when it hit me, Lysa pretended to be Catelyn, raped little Petyr Baelish and that led him to believe Cat was in love with him. Thus misguided, he challenged her fiancé for a duel, lost, interpreted her pleading to spare his life as a sacrifice she made for love (when she did that because she had no idea why the hell her friend challenged Stark in the first place, she thought he was just being a naïve boy -ironically, she was right but not for the reason whe though). After that, look what we get: - Cat one day appears on LF doors (in the first book). -He professes love for her, she thinks that's just a nostalgic infatuation and refuses him - He responds to that with something to the effect of "well, I know she is too honorable to be unfaithful, that perfect woman of my dreams, I better get her husband out of the picture so she is free to confess herself to me without feeling guilty". -He betrays Ned, "coincidently" making Cat a widow. Now he only has to wait... dang, a war, that complicate things, a good chance to make himself a noble high enough to marry her, though... "I wonder who is holding Harrenhal...". (correct me if I'm wrong, but he never chance to meet Catelyn again after that, does he?) -His machination, unintentionally lead to Cat's death. -He bets all his coins in getting Sansa, because she looks exactly like her mother when "they" fell in love. He tells Sansa his version of the events in saying that he slept with Catelyn and that she never really loved her husband, he is being, as far as he knows, honest, but we have no way to know that. -Lysa confesses that SHE was the one who slept with him. He puts 2 and 2 together. Her lie costs him: -the loss of his place as a ward in Riverun as a kid -his naïvete -the chance of keeping his friendship with Cat after she married, if the duel never happened -the Seven knows what chances of having a healthy relationship with someone if he was not too busy believing that the one he loved was into him, somewhere else, both separated only by her honor and his low social standing. -ultimatelly, Catelyn herself, because Lysa's lie resulted in a snowball that quite cruelly ended with LF actions being the cause of Cat's death. And, at that point, he KNEW he was indirectly guilty of her death and now, knew it was for nothing, that she never even knew he loved her, so all his plans and the war was... moot. A sick joke of destiny, if you ask me. I would say that's enough to make a man push a woman through a door and go a little bonkers. Soooo, Lf is the smartest man in any room he is in, but life had him be fooled only once, and by the least inteligent woman in all of Westeros: Lysa Tully-Arryn. That doesn't make him less of a genius, but makes him more humane in his failing. I'm pretty sure about my interpretation of events, but all of that was just implied in the book. Implying is something Martin does quite wonderfully.
